Coin description

Giotto's Campanile in Florence alongside a portrait of Giotto derived from a painting by Paolo Uccello; the inscription "GIOTTO" and the dates "1267" and "2017"; the country name "SAN MARINO", the initials of designer Luciana de Simoni and the "R" mintmark.

Further information

Giotto di Bondone is regarded as one of the most consequential innovators in European art history. Born around 1267 in Vespignano, Tuscany, he broke with the previously dominant Byzantine pictorial tradition and, for the first time, gave human figures physical presence, depth and emotional credibility. His fresco cycles in the Scrovegni Chapel in Padua and in the Upper Church of Assisi are regarded as milestones on the path to the Renaissance. Giotto also left a lasting architectural mark: the campanile at Florence Cathedral named after him, which he began to design around 1334, is among the most significant Gothic buildings in Italy. In the 16th century, Giorgio Vasari called him the re-founder of painting - a judgement that still resonates today.

San Marino's connection to Giotto is cultural in nature: the republic, surrounded entirely by Italian territory, shares with Tuscany and Umbria the common art-historical space in which Giotto's work was created and received. San Marino has issued its own commemorative coins since the introduction of the euro, regularly honouring figures and events of wider significance. On the 750th anniversary of Giotto's birth in 2017, the small state honoured the Florentine master with a 2-euro commemorative coin - a reference to the shared cultural heritage of the Italian-speaking world.
